The given polynomial is

10x^7-9x^2+15x^3+9

In standard form of a polynomial, the terms are arranged according to its degree from left to right. It means term with highest degree should be on the left side.

Degree of 10x^7,-9x^2,15x^3\text{ and }9 are 7, 2, 3 and 0.

Arrange the terms according to its degree.

10x^7+15x^3-9x^2+9

Hence, the correct option is B.
